Representatives of the Masaryk Institute of Advanced Studies, Faculty of Electrical Engineering, ERA-BHC CS s.r.o., Omnipol, a.s., CybEe and Ambassador of Estonia in the Czech Republic signed a contract to provide the Cyber Hygiene e-Learning Software platform. It consists of one thousand user licenses for the needs of university students and employees. For now the licence will be available for a period of two years, provided in cooperation with the distributor of this platform for the Czech Republic, ERA-HBC CS s.r.o., intended for use by selected academic staff and students of Masaryk Institute of Advanced Studies and the Department of Telecommunication Technology of the Faculty of Electrical Engineering.

Students will be introduced to one of the important tools for maintaining cyber security and the software producer will get qualified feedback. This will help further develop and better apply the product in the specific environment of academia with high software requirements.
